The global Food Waste Management Software market is experiencing robust growth, driven by increasing awareness of environmental sustainability and the economic benefits of reducing food waste. The market, estimated at $2 billion in 2025, is projected to exhibit a healthy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 15% from 2025 to 2033, reaching approximately $6 billion by 2033. Key drivers include stringent government regulations aimed at curtailing food waste, rising consumer demand for eco-friendly practices, and the increasing adoption of advanced technologies like AI and IoT within the food supply chain. The cloud-based segment holds a significant market share, owing to its scalability, accessibility, and cost-effectiveness compared to local deployment. The enterprise sector dominates application-wise, reflecting the substantial volumes of food handled by large organizations. However, the municipal and residential segments are exhibiting rapid growth, indicating a broader market penetration driven by rising awareness and technological advancements making these solutions more affordable and user-friendly. Geographic analysis reveals North America and Europe as leading markets, but Asia-Pacific is anticipated to register the fastest growth, driven by expanding economies and increasing urbanization in regions like China and India. Restraints to market growth include the high initial investment costs associated with implementing software solutions and the need for robust technical expertise for seamless integration and operation.
The competitive landscape is fragmented, featuring both established players and emerging startups. Companies like Winnow Solutions, Leanpath, and RecycleERP are making significant inroads with their innovative solutions. However, the market's growth potential is attracting new entrants, fostering innovation and competition. The success of individual companies hinges on their ability to deliver user-friendly interfaces, robust data analytics capabilities, and seamless integration with existing food management systems. Future market developments are likely to see increased integration of AI-powered predictive analytics for better waste prevention strategies, further strengthening the market's long-term prospects. Furthermore, the trend towards subscription-based models and bundled services is expected to broaden market accessibility and drive revenue growth.

Several key factors are driving the expansion of the food waste management software market. Firstly, the escalating global concern regarding environmental sustainability is a major impetus. Food waste contributes significantly to greenhouse gas emissions, and reducing it is a critical step towards mitigating climate change. Governments worldwide are implementing stricter regulations and incentives to encourage businesses to adopt sustainable practices, including the implementation of food waste management systems. Secondly, the significant economic burden associated with food waste is prompting businesses to seek cost-effective solutions. Software solutions offer the potential for substantial cost savings through improved inventory management, optimized procurement processes, and reduced disposal costs. Thirdly, the increasing demand for transparency and traceability within the food supply chain is driving the adoption of technology-enabled solutions. Consumers are increasingly conscious of the environmental and social impact of their food choices, demanding greater accountability from businesses. Food waste management software allows businesses to track and monitor their waste generation throughout the entire supply chain, providing the data needed to meet growing consumer expectations. Finally, the continuous advancements in technology, such as the integ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ning, are enhancing the capabilities of food waste management software, making it more effective and efficient. These advanced analytics provide valuable insights that enable businesses to optimize their operations and significantly reduce waste.
Despite the significant growth potential, the food waste management software market faces several challenges. One major hurdle is the high initial investment cost associated with implementing these systems, particularly for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) with limited budgets. Furthermore, the complexity of integrating these systems with existing infrastructure and workflows can present significant technical difficulties, requiring specialized expertise and time-consuming implementation processes. Data security and privacy concerns are also important considerations, particularly given the sensitive nature of the data collected by these systems. Ensuring compliance with relevant data protection regulations is crucial for building trust and maintaining user confidence. Lack of awareness among businesses regarding the benefits of implementing food waste management software is another significant barrier. Many organizations may not fully understand the potential cost savings and environmental benefits, hindering their willingness to adopt these solutions. Finally, the accuracy and reliability of the data collected by the software can vary depending on the quality of the input data and the accuracy of the sensors used. Inaccurate data can lead to ineffective interventions and limit the overall effectiveness of the system.
The cloud-based segment is poised to dominate the food waste management software market throughout the forecast period (2025-2033). Cloud-based solutions offer unparalleled scalability, accessibility, and cost-effectiveness compared to on-premise systems. Their flexibility allows businesses of all sizes to easily adopt the software, regardless of their technical expertise or infrastructure capabilities. This accessibility is particularly impactful in driving adoption among smaller enterprises which previously lacked the resources for robust waste management systems.
North America is expected to be a leading region, due to a strong focus on sustainability initiatives, heightened consumer awareness, and the presence of several market-leading technology providers. The high level of technological adoption and readily available infrastructure further contributes to its dominance. Stringent environmental regulations and significant government investments in sustainable initiatives will propel market growth.
Europe follows closely behind, driven by similar factors to North America, including increased regulatory pressure and a strong commitment to environmental sustainability. The European Union’s commitment to reducing food waste across the entire food chain significantly boosts the demand for effective management solutions.
Asia-Pacific is demonstrating rapid growth, driven by a combination of factors: growing awareness of environmental issues, rapid economic development, and increasing urbanization. The region's expanding food processing and hospitality industries also drive the need for efficient waste management. While potentially lagging behind North America and Europe in terms of overall market size, the Asia-Pacific region shows a much higher rate of growth, making it a significant area for future market expansion.
The enterprise application segment holds a significant share, as large corporations are at the forefront of adopting efficient waste management strategies to reduce costs, enhance brand image, and demonstrate their commitment to sustainable practices. The ability to monitor waste across multiple locations and integrate with existing en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ems makes cloud-based solutions particularly attractive for large enterprises. The municipal segment is also experiencing notable growth, as governments at various levels recognize the significance of food waste reduction and strive to implement comprehensive waste management programs. Software solutions aid in efficiently monitoring waste streams, improving the efficiency of collection services, and facilitating data-driven decision-making for effective waste management policies.
